The Ack Delay Report complements the packet delay report for transport and answer<br />
commands, to give statistics on the acks created and dropped as well as the delay for the<br />
ack. The ack delay is a round trip delay from when the packet started to when the ack<br />
returned. The time starts with the last packet that results in sending the ack.<br />
Number of Acks Created and Dropped<br />
The number of acks created and dropped in response to the<br />
source message.<br />
Delay (MS)—Average, Maximum, Standard Deviation Ack Delay<br />
The average, maximum and standard deviation of the delay for<br />
the ack in response to the source message.<br />
